Soufflé Omelette

Soufflé Omelette is a traditional French recipe for a classic omelette made lighter by the folding of whipped egg whites into the egg and milk batter that makes the omelette lighter. The full recipe is presented here and I hope you enjoy this classic French version of: Soufflé Omelette.

Ingredients:

2 eggs, separated
2 tbsp milk
salt and freshly-ground black pepper
knob of butter, for frying

Method:

Whisk together the egg yolks and milk until smooth then season to taste with salt and black pepper. Whisk the egg whites until they form peaks then fold into the egg yolk blend.

Heat the butter in a small non-stick pan and when foaming add the egg mix. Cook, without stirring, until the base of the omelette is golden brown then place under a hot grill and cook until browned on top and heated through.

Score the puffed-up omelette down the centre using a sharp knife (do not cut through), add your choice of topping to one half of the omelette (truffles are excellent here and cheese is another classic) then fold the other half of the omelette over and serve.
